75mm Bars - 12V Digital RGB LED Pixels (Strand of 21) [WS2801]

Digitally-controllable RGB LED pixel bars using WS2801 driver chips. Each 75mm plastic PVC bar contains 3× 5050 RGB LEDs and a controller chip, epoxy-flooded for waterproof outdoor use. Sold as a strand of 21 pixels — ideal for building large RGB 7-segment displays.

The pixels connect via a 4-conductor cable (+12V DC, ground, data, and clock). Data shifts from one pixel to the next, so strands can be cut or extended as needed. Each pixel is individually addressable with 24-bit colour (8-bit PWM per channel). Multiple strands can be daisy-chained using the JST SM 3-pin connectors.

Key Features

  • 21 Pixels Per Strand – 75mm bar format with 3× 5050 RGB LEDs each
  • WS2801 Controller – 24-bit colour, individually addressable
  • Waterproof – Epoxy-flooded PVC enclosure
  • 12V DC – Constant-current driven for even colour throughout
  • Chainable – JST SM connectors for extending strands
  • Mounting Options – Flanges with 4mm holes and adhesive foam tape
  • 120° Beam Width – ~4000mcd total brightness per pixel

Specifications

  • LEDs Per Pixel – 3× 5050 RGB (controlled as one unit)
  • Pixel Size – 75mm bar
  • Voltage – 12V DC
  • Interface – 2-wire (data + clock), any two digital pins
  • Connectors – JST SM 3-pin (data), separate power wires
Tip: A 12V 5A power supply can drive 3 or more strands depending on current usage. Use a 2.1mm terminal block adapter to connect the separate power wires.
